Lithium and Quinapril Drug Interaction

Summary

The combination of lithium and quinapril represents a clinically significant drug interaction that can lead to increased lithium serum levels and potential lithium toxicity. This interaction occurs because quinapril, an ACE inhibitor, can reduce lithium clearance by the kidneys, requiring careful monitoring and possible dose adjustments.

Introduction

Lithium is a mood stabilizer primarily used to treat bipolar disorder and as an adjunct therapy for major depressive disorder. It belongs to the class of antimanic agents and works by modulating neurotransmitter activity in the brain. Quinapril is an angiotensin-converting enzyme (ACE) inhibitor commonly prescribed for hypertension and heart failure. It works by blocking the conversion of angiotensin I to angiotensin II, leading to vasodilation and reduced blood pressure. Both medications are frequently prescribed, making their potential interaction clinically relevant.

Mechanism of Interaction

The interaction between lithium and quinapril occurs through quinapril's effect on renal lithium clearance. ACE inhibitors like quinapril can reduce glomerular filtration rate and alter sodium handling in the kidneys. Since lithium is primarily eliminated through the kidneys and its clearance is closely linked to sodium reabsorption, quinapril can decrease lithium elimination. This reduction in renal clearance leads to increased lithium serum concentrations, potentially reaching toxic levels even when lithium dosing remains unchanged.

Risks and Symptoms

The primary risk of this interaction is lithium toxicity, which can manifest as neurological symptoms including tremor, confusion, ataxia, and in severe cases, seizures or coma. Early signs of lithium toxicity may include nausea, vomiting, diarrhea, and increased urination. The interaction is considered clinically significant because lithium has a narrow therapeutic window, and even modest increases in serum levels can lead to toxicity. Patients with pre-existing kidney disease, dehydration, or those taking other medications affecting renal function are at higher risk for developing complications from this interaction.

Management and Precautions

When lithium and quinapril must be used together, close monitoring is essential. Baseline lithium serum levels should be established before starting quinapril, followed by frequent monitoring (weekly initially, then every 2-4 weeks) until levels stabilize. Lithium doses may need to be reduced by 25-50% when initiating quinapril therapy. Patients should be educated about signs and symptoms of lithium toxicity and advised to maintain adequate hydration. Regular monitoring of kidney function, electrolytes, and clinical symptoms is crucial. Healthcare providers should consider alternative antihypertensive agents if possible, or ensure robust monitoring protocols are in place when the combination is necessary.

Lithium interactions with food and lifestyle

Lithium has several important food and lifestyle interactions that require careful monitoring. Sodium intake significantly affects lithium levels - both low sodium diets and sudden increases in sodium intake can alter lithium concentrations and potentially lead to toxicity or reduced effectiveness. Patients should maintain consistent sodium intake and avoid drastic dietary changes. Adequate fluid intake (8-10 glasses of water daily) is essential, as dehydration can increase lithium levels and risk of toxicity. Caffeine intake should be kept consistent, as sudden changes in caffeine consumption can affect lithium levels. Alcohol should be avoided or used with extreme caution, as it can increase the risk of lithium toxicity and may worsen mood symptoms. Patients should also avoid excessive sweating through intense exercise or saunas without proper hydration, as fluid loss can concentrate lithium levels. These interactions are well-documented in major drug databases and clinical guidelines, requiring regular monitoring of lithium blood levels.

Quinapril interactions with food and lifestyle

Quinapril should be taken on an empty stomach, as food can reduce its absorption by approximately 25-30%. Take quinapril at least 1 hour before or 2 hours after meals for optimal effectiveness. Alcohol consumption should be limited while taking quinapril, as it may enhance the blood pressure-lowering effects and increase the risk of dizziness, lightheadedness, or fainting. Salt substitutes containing potassium should be used with caution, as quinapril can increase potassium levels in the blood.
